Dr. Michelle Gentile, MD is a radiation oncologist in Philadelphia, PA and has over 10 years of experience in the medical field. She graduated from Northwestern University Feinberg School of Medicine in 2010. She is affiliated with medical facilities Hospital of the University of Pennsylvania and Pennsylvania Hospital.
